【asp源码栏目提醒】:以下是网学会员为您推荐的asp源码-ASP语法基础 - 操作系统,希望本篇文章对您学习有所帮助。
IT Education TrainingIT Education TrainingIT Education TrainingIT Education Training内容简介??基本语法规则??VBScript??JavaScript??
ASP 变量??
ASP 子程序IT Education TrainingIT Education Training实例???? ?? ?? ?? IT Education TrainingIT Education Training基本语法规则??通常情况下
ASP 文件包含着HTML 标签类似
HTML 文件。
不过
ASP 文件也可包含服务器端脚本这些脚本被包围起来。
服务器脚本在服务器端执行可包含合法的表达式、语句、或者运算符。
IT Education TrainingIT Education TrainingVBScript??你可以在
ASP 中使用若干种脚本语言。
不过默认的脚本语言是VBScript??例??VBScript的过程和函数Sub 过程IT Education TrainingIT Education TrainingFunction函数包含在Function和End Function语句之间通过函数名返回一个值。
函数的返回值总是variant数据类型。
Function函数名参数表 语句序列函数名表达式End FunctionSub ConvertTemp temp InputBox“请输入华氏温度” 1 MsgBox “温度为” Celsiustemp “摄氏度。
”End Sub FunctionCelsiusfDegreesCelsius fDegrees -32 5 / 9 End FunctionFunction 函数IT Education TrainingIT Education TrainingASP 子程序javascript?? ???? ?? ??Result: ?? ?? IT Education TrainingIT Education Training??1.函数的定义function 函数名形式参数表函数体??2.函数的调用一种是语句调用一种是事件调用。
JavaScript函数例3.16 函数的定义与调用。
程序3-15.htm IT Education TrainingIT Education Training实例四调用使用VBScript 和JavaScript 的子程序?? ?? ?? ??结果 ??结果 ?? ?? IT Education TrainingIT Education TrainingVBScript 与JavaScript 之间的差异??
VBScript 与
JavaScript 之间的差异??当从一个用VBScript 编写的
ASP 文件中调用VBScript 或者JavaScript 子程序时可以使用关键词“call”后面跟着子程序名称。
??假如子程序需要参数当使用关键词“call” 时必须使用括号包围参数。
??假如省略“call”参数则不必由括号包围。
??假如子程序没有参数那么括号则是可选项。
??当从一个用JavaScript 编写的
ASP 文件中调用VBScript 或者JavaScript 子程序时必须在子程序名后使用括号。
IT Education TrainingIT Education TrainingASP程序的编写注意事项??1所有
ASP语句段都使用标记来界定。
??2
ASP语句可以与HTML标记结合使用但必须用各自的界定符隔开。
??3VBScript是默认的脚本语言如需改变可在代码前加以声明?? ?? ??4若脚本是VBScript字母不区分大小写若是JavaScript则大小写敏感。
??5
ASP语句必须分行写。
不能将多条
ASP语句写在一行里。
如果
ASP语句太长一行写不下可用续行符“_”下划线。
??6
ASP的注释语句为‘注释内容IT Education TrainingIT Education TrainingASP文件引用??如果要在一个
ASP文件中重复调用一段子程序或语句集或在多个
ASP文件中调用一段子程序或语句集可以将这段子程序或语句集单独放在一个后缀为.inc的文件中该文件称为被引用文件included file。
??在调用这段子程序或语句集的
ASP文件中将“被引用文件”包含进来该
ASP文件就叫引用文件including files。
IT Education TrainingIT Education Training包含included file的
ASP页面Now the time is: 下面是被引用文件time.inc文件的内容IT Education TrainingIT Education Traininginclude命令要在
ASP页面中引用文件需在注释标签中使用include命令格式如下或说明1filename 是被引用的文件名其文件后缀是.inc。
2virtual表示被引用文件的路径开始于虚拟目录。
3file指示一个相对路径。
相对路径开始于含有当前文件的目录。
IT Education TrainingIT Education Training创建
ASP.NET应用程序的步骤??创建新项目??创建界面??编写代码??生成项目??测试和调试??部署课堂操作
演示IT Education TrainingIT Education Training??Label1.Text HELLO TextBox1.TextIT Education TrainingIT Education TrainingC
常用项目模版项目模板说明Windows 应用
程序用于创建标准的Windows应用程序这种模板自动添加应用程序开始所必需的项目引用和文件类库用于创建可与其他项目共享的、可重用的类和组件Windows 控件库用于创建要在Windows窗体中使用的自定义控件
ASP.NET Web 应用程序用于在安装了IIS 5.0或其后续版本的
计算机上创建
ASP.
NET Web应用程序这种模板创建了服务器端所必需的基本文件
ASP.NET Web 服务用于编写一个能被
网络中其他Web服务或应用程序使用的XML Web ServiceWeb 控件库用于创建自定义的Web服务器控件。
这种模板用于添加在开始创建控件时所必需的项目项所创建的控件可以放置到任何Web项目中控制台应用程序用于创建控制台应用程序。
通常将控制台应用程序
设计为无图形的UI并编译成独立的可执行文件。
控制台应用程序通常从命令行运行同时在命令提示和运行的应用程序之间交换输入、输出信息Windows 服务用于创建Windows服务应用程序。
该应用程序是一种在其自己的Windows会话中长时间运行的可执行应用程序空项目用于创建特有的项目类型。
这种模板创建存储应用程序信息所必需的文件结构任何引用、文件或组件必须手工添加到这种模板中空Web项目用于希望以空项目开始的高级用户。
这种模板在IIS服务器上为基于服务器的项目创建必需的文件结构必须手工添加引用和组件如Web窗体页在现有文件夹中创建新项目用于在现有应用程序目录中创建空白项目。
然后可以选择将预先存在的应用程序目录中的文件添加到此新项目中方法是在解决
方案资源管理器中逐一右击这些项并选择快捷菜单中的【包括在项目中】项IT Education TrainingIT Education Training